S 780 · 108th Congress · Commemorations

Chief Martin Congressional Gold Medal Act

Introduced 2003-04-03· Sponsored by Sen. Lott, Trent [R-MS]· Senate

Latest: Read twice and referred to the Committee on Banking, Housing, and Urban Affairs.(2003-04-03)

Plain Language Summary

[AI summary unavailable — showing source text] Chief Martin Congressional Gold Medal Act - Directs the Speaker of the House of Representatives and the President Pro Tempore of the Senate to arrange for the presentation, on behalf of Congress, of a gold medal to Chief Phillip Martin in recognition of his leadership of the Mississippi Band of Choctaw Indians for over 45 years and for his contributions to the American Indian community, particularly to the native and non-native communities of Mississippi.…
